The cabriolet BMW 3er 2005 - 2008 year modification 3.0 MT (231 hp)

Engine

Engine type diesel
Engine location front, longitudinal
Engine capacity, cm³ 2993
Boost type turbocharging
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 231 / 170 at 4000
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 500 at 1750
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 6
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system engine with undivided combustion chambers (direct fuel injection)
Compression ratio 17
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 84 × 90

General information

Brand country Germany
Model assembly Germany
Car class D
Number of doors 2

Performance indicators

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ined 9.3 / 5.3 / 6.8
Fuel type diesel fuel
Maximum speed, km/h 245
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s 7

Sizes in mm

Length 4580
Width 1782
Height 1384
Wheelbase 2760
Ground clearance 138
Front track width 1500
Rear track width 1513
Wheel size 225 / 45 / R17

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disk ventilated
Rear brakes disc

Transmission

Transmission mechanical
Number of gears 6
Drive type rear

Volume and weight

Fuel tank capacity, l 63
Curb weight, kg 1755
Trunk volume min/max, l 210 / 350
Gross weight, kg 2180

BMW 3er Cabriolet: A Blend of Performance and Elegance

The BMW 3er Cabriolet, produced between 2005 and 2008, is a testament to German engineering and luxury. This two-door convertible combines the thrill of open-top driving with the precision and performance that BMW is renowned for. With its sleek design, powerful diesel engine, and advanced features, the 3er Cabriolet is a standout in the D-class segment.

Performance and Efficiency

Under the hood, the BMW 3er Cabriolet boasts a 3.0-liter inline-6 diesel engine, delivering an impressive 231 horsepower and 500 Nm of torque. The turbocharged engine ensures rapid acceleration, with the car reaching 100 km/h in just 7 seconds. The maximum speed is capped at 245 km/h, making it a formidable contender on both city streets and highways. Despite its power, the 3er Cabriolet maintains a respectable fuel efficiency, with combined consumption of 6.8 liters per 100 kilometers.

Design and Dimensions

The cabriolet body type exudes sophistication, with a length of 4580 mm, width of 1782 mm, and height of 1384 mm. The wheelbase of 2760 mm provides a stable and comfortable ride, while the ground clearance of 138 mm ensures practicality on various road surfaces. The car's weight is well-distributed, with a curb weight of 1755 kg and a gross weight of 2180 kg, contributing to its balanced handling.

Interior and Practicality

Inside, the BMW 3er Cabriolet offers a blend of luxury and functionality. The trunk volume ranges from 210 to 350 liters, providing ample space for luggage or groceries. The fuel tank capacity of 63 liters ensures fewer stops on long journeys, enhancing the overall driving experience.

Suspension and Braking

The car features an independent spring suspension system, both at the front and rear, ensuring a smooth and controlled ride. The ventilated disc brakes at the front and standard disc brakes at the rear provide reliable stopping power, adding to the car's safety credentials.
